This paper presents the results of field geophysical testing and laboratory testing of peat from Carn Park and Roosky raised bogs in the Irish Midlands. The motivation for the work was highlight the importance of these areas and to begin to attempt to understand the reasons for the failure of the bogs despite them having surface slopes of some 1°. It was found that the peat is typical of that of Irish raised bogs being up to 8 m thick towards the “high” dome of the bogs. The peat is characterised by low density, high water content, high organic content, low undrained shear strength and high compressibility. The peat is also relatively permeable at in situ stress. Geophysical electrical resistivity tomography and ground penetrating radar data shows a clear thinning of the peat in the area of the failures corresponding to a reduction in volume from dewatering by edge drains/peat harvesting. This finding is supported by detailed water content measurements. It was also shown that the peat base topography is relatively flat and indicates that the observed surface movement has come from within the peat rather than from the material below the peat. Potential causes of the failures include conventional slope instability, the effect of seepage forces or the release of built-up gas in the peat mass. Further measurements are required in order to study these in more detail.  相似文献

A case study of slope stability mapping is presented for the A Luoi district situated in the mountainous western part of Thua Thien-Hue Province in Central Vietnam, where slope failures occur frequently and seriously affect local living conditions. The methodology is based on the infinite slope stability model, which calculates a safety factor as the ratio between shear strength and shear stress. The triggering mechanism for slope instability considered in the analysis is the maximum daily precipitation recorded in a 28-year period (1976–2003) taking into account runoff and infiltration predicted with a hydrological model. All necessary physical parameters are derived from topography, soil texture, and land use, in GIS-raster grid format with pixel size of 30 by 30 m. Results of the analysis are compared with a slope failure inventory map of 2001, showing that more than 86.9 % of the existing slope failures are well predicted by the physically based slope stability model. It can be concluded that the larger part of the study area is prone to landsliding. The resulting slope stability map is useful for further research and land-use planning, but for precise prediction of future slope failures, more effort is needed with respect to spatial variation of causative factors and analysis techniques.  相似文献

康定县地热资源丰富,但开发利用少,仅2008-2009年由四川省地质工程勘察院在中谷地区实施地热勘探井2口,钻探深度共计184.96m。DZK02井是部署在四川省雅拉河中上游热水塘区块地热资源大盖沟沟口雅拉河右岸一级阶地上的第一口预探井,设计井深2 000m。钻井施工主要面临地层倾角大、地层出水量大、温度高、岩性破碎等施工难题。施工队伍采用螺杆纠斜、清水控压等钻井工艺,圆满完成了该井的施工任务。为该地区地热水的开发利用进行了有益的尝试。  相似文献

This contribution analyzes the similarities and differences between the measured activities of 137Cs and excess 210pb (210Pbex) in the cultivated brown and cinnamon soils of the Yimeng Mountain area, discusses the influ- ence of soil texture on the measurement of 210Pbex, and presents differences between the two types of soils. Fields A and B were selected to represent the fields that contain cultivated brown and cinnamon soils, respectively. From either study field, one site of sectioned core and six bulk cores were collected to measure 137Cs levels, 210Pbex levels, and the particle-size composition of soil samples. Three undisturbed soil samples were collected to measure capillary and aeration porosities. The 137Cs inventories for the two study fields are very similar. The 137Cs is a man-made ra- dionuclide, which means that its measured levels for soils are unaffected by soil texture. In contrast, levels of the naturally occurring 210Pbex of soils from Field A were lower than those of Field B by about 50%. In contrast to aquatic sediments, levels of 210Pbex in terrestrial surface soils are affected by the emanation of 222Rn from the soils. It can be assumed that the coarser the soils, the greater the emanation of 222Rn; in addition, the lower the measured 210pbex, the greater the underestimate of this value. The cultivated brown soils in Field A are coarser than the culti- vated cinnamon soils in Field B. As a result, 222Rn in Field A will diffuse more easily into the atmosphere than that in Field B. As a consequence, the measured 210pbex in soils from Field A is much lower than the actual value, whereas the value measured for Field B is much closer to the actual value.  相似文献

为准确测定铀钍混合型矿床中矿层的铀、钍含量,研制了 N451型伽玛能谱测井探管,并将该探管配接在 HD 4002B轻型综合测井系统上组成了伽玛能谱测井系统.基于该系统,建立了伽玛能谱测井仪的校正方法、伽玛能谱测井的数据处理方法和野外测井工作方法.N451型伽玛能谱测井探管具有探测效率高、自动稳谱系统抗辐射能力强的特点,在铀矿勘查中连续测定钻孔中矿层的U、Th含量,效果良好.  相似文献

A nonlinear ensemble prediction model for typhoon rainstorm has been developed based on particle swarm optimization-neural network (PSO-NN). In this model, PSO algorithm is employed for optimizing the network structure and initial weight of the NN with creating multiple ensemble members. The model input of the ensemble member is the high correlated grid point factors selected from the rainfall forecast field of Japan Meteorological Agency numerical prediction products using the stepwise regression method, and the model output is the future 24 h rainfall forecast of the 89 stations. Results show that the objective prediction model is more accurate than the numerical prediction model which is directly interpolated into the stations, so it can better been implemented for the interpretation and application of numerical prediction products, indicating a potentially better operational weather prediction.  相似文献

四川盆地中部上三叠统须家河须组须二段砂岩储层是中国低渗致密砂岩的突出代表,成岩作用对于砂岩致密化具有重要影响。借助铸体薄片、阴极发光、电子探针、扫描电镜等实验分析手段,分析不同成岩作用类型及特征,以控制孔隙演化的主要或特征的成岩作用划分出6种成岩相;引入视压实率、视胶结率、视微孔率、成岩系数结合孔渗参数,定量评价不同成岩作用强度,区分不同成岩相类型;探索地应用稳健回归方法建立孔渗-成岩系数解释模型;利用成岩系数解释模型解释未取心井参数,绘制成岩系数等值线平面图,预测有利成岩相区域分布。绘制储层(孔隙度6%)成岩系数等值线平面图,预测有利成岩相-有利储层发育区,实现了成岩作用、成岩相定量评价,成岩相的快速预测,并为有利储层发育区的筛选提供了依据,对于致密砂岩气藏勘探开发具有指导性意义。  相似文献

为有效应对海洋环境污染和保护海洋生态环境,文章在明确海洋环境污染突发事件基本概念、分类和特征的基础上,分析我国海洋环境污染突发事件应急处置的立法现状和存在的不足,并提出对策建议。研究结果表明:海洋环境污染突发事件是突发环境事件的种类之一,成因可归为自然因素和人为因素,具有污染源复杂、突然性和不确定性、危害后果严重以及应急处置艰难等特征;目前我国宪法和法律针对突发环境事件有相关规定,而专门规制海洋环境污染突发事件应急处置的法律规范多见于行政法规和规章;以问题为导向,构建我国海洋环境污染突发事件应急处置法律体系应进一步完善应急预案制度、完善风险信息收集途经、明确执法主体职能职责和建立应急联动机制、健全公众参与制度、建立企业信息通报问责制度以及完善后续调查评估制度和相关补偿制度。  相似文献
